The Marquesas Islands, part of French Polynesia, are a group of 10 islands clustered near the equator, in the Pacific, about 930 miles from Tahiti. These remote islands are volcanic, rugged and wild, with steep cliffs and deep valleys. They are not protected by coral reefs as the Society Islands are and surf crashes ashore against sheer cliffs or on black sand beaches. The island interiors are inhabited by wild horses, cattle and goats, and there is an abundance of papayas, bananas, mangoes and other fruits grown.

It is widely held that the ancestors of the Polynesians arrived here around 1000 BC. The name Marquesas comes from a Spanish explorer who, in the 16th century, discovered the four southern islands and named them after the Viceroy of Peru’s wife who had financed his explorations.

Nuku Hiva, in the northern group, is the largest island in the chain and is also the most populous, with about 2400 inhabitants. Hiva Oa, in the southern group, is the second largest. It is here the artist, Paul Gauguin, and the famed singer, Jacques Brel, are buried.
